I-claim:
1. The method of reducing the curling tendency of finished photographic film which comprises treatingsaid film after processing with an aqueous solution containing from 2% to 1.5% of a water-soluble amide.
2. The method of reducing the curling tendency of finished photographic film which comprises treating said film after processing with a 2% to 7.5% aqueous solution of urea.
33. The method of reducing the tendency of v finished photographic film to curl when subjected to high relative humidity, which comprises immersing said film after development and fixing in a 2% to 7.5% aqueous solution of urea.
4. The method of reducing the tendency of finished photographic film to curl when subjected to high relative humidity, which comprises immersing said .film after development and fixing in a 2% to 7.5% aqueous solution of urea.
5. The method of reducing the tendency of finished photographic film to curl when subjected to high relative humidity, which comprises immersing said film for about 10 minutes in a 2% to 7.5% aqueous solution of urea and then drying said film.
